Appropriate Preposition:

  • Open to ( উন্মুক্ত ) His plan is open to objection.
  • Overcome by ( দমন করা ) He was overcome by anger.
  • Zealous for ( আগ্রহী ) He is zealous for improvement.
  • Envious of ( ঈর্ষান্বিত ) I am not envious of his riches.
  • Escape by ( রক্ষা করা ) He escaped by a hair breadth.
  • Impose on ( চাপানো ) The task was imposed on him.

Idioms:

  • Weal and woe ( সুখ-দুঃখ ) Human life is full of weal and woe.
  • Make both ends meet ( আয়ব্যয় মেলানো ) I cannot make both ends meet with my small income.
  • Book worm ( গ্রন্থকীট ) Don't be a book worm.
  • Fish out of water ( অস্বস্তিকর অবস্থায় ) When he came to the village, he felt like a fish out of water.
  • Irony of fate ( ভাগ্যের পরিহাস ) He could not succeed by irony of fate.
  • tickled pink ( খুব খুশি করানো ) She was tickled pink by the good news.
